ParserErrorCollection.Contains(ParserError)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Determina si el ParserError objeto se encuentra en la colección.
public:
bool Contains(System::Web::ParserError ^ value);
public bool Contains(System.Web.ParserError value);
member this.Contains : System.Web.ParserError -> bool
Public Function Contains (value As ParserError) As Boolean
Parámetros
- value
- ParserError
que ParserError se va a buscar en la colección.
Devoluciones
true es si está ParserError en la colección; de lo contrario, falsees .
Ejemplos
En el ejemplo de código siguiente se muestra cómo buscar una instancia de un objeto especificado ParserError en un ParserErrorCollection objeto .
// Test for the presence of a ParserError in the
// collection, and retrieve its index if it is found.
ParserError testError = new ParserError("Error", "Path", 1);
int itemIndex = -1;
if (collection.Contains(testError))
itemIndex = collection.IndexOf(testError);
' Test for the presence of a ParserError in the
' collection, and retrieve its index if it is found.
Dim testError As New ParserError("Error", "Path", 1)
Dim itemIndex As Integer = -1
If collection.Contains(testError) Then
itemIndex = collection.IndexOf(testError)
End If
Comentarios
No se puede agregar el mismo ParserError objeto a la colección más de una vez. Sin embargo, al intentar agregar un ParserError objeto más de una vez no se producirá una excepción. En su lugar, se producirá un error en la adición. En este caso, el Add método devolverá un valor de -1. Sin embargo, los AddRange métodos y Insert no tienen valores devueltos. Al agregar ParserError objetos mediante uno de estos métodos, use el Contains método para determinar si un objeto determinado ParserError ya está en la colección.